Costs depend on size, thickness, access and whether reinforcement is required. As a guide, small shed bases often start around £450–£900, while larger summerhouse or greenhouse bases commonly fall between £900–£2,000. Hot tub and garage bases with thicker slabs, steel mesh and upgraded sub-bases can range from £1,800–£4,500+. We’ll provide a detailed quote after checking levels, drainage and access in SW1.
Most single bases are completed in 1–2 days, including excavation, sub-base preparation and the pour. Larger or reinforced bases may take 2–4 days, particularly if access is tight or spoil removal is complex. Concrete typically needs time to cure before heavy loading; light foot traffic is usually fine after 24–48 hours, but hot tubs and structures may need 7–14 days depending on weather and specification.
In many cases, a concrete base for a shed, summerhouse or greenhouse is permitted development, provided the structure meets height and location rules. However, the City of Westminster can have additional considerations for listed buildings, conservation areas and front-garden works. Drainage and surface water run-off can also matter, especially if you’re hardstanding a larger area. We’ll flag likely requirements and help you check before work starts.

We can install standard concrete slabs, reinforced slabs with steel mesh, and thicker specifications for hot tubs and garage bases. Finishes include smooth float, brushed anti-slip, or a slightly textured surface depending on use. We also build in drainage falls and can add gravel margins or edging details where needed.
